Stephen, DXF export is very easy from Playmation or Anim. Master. But, you need to have the latest Revs. Playmation 1.48 or later should have the Export DXF command in the file menu. If not, call Hash Inc. at 206-699-5360 and get it. The real problem with export DXF is the playmation file structure. First open a segment you want to export. Then click Export DXF in file menu. Then comes the problems. In the window that comes up, go to the far right and click the Project Name. That will highlight it. Click Save. That will bring up the projectt names in the center window. Double click on the project directory. That will open the file to the segments. Then in the left window, you see the segment name highlighted. The Save name window should be empty. Type in the name you want for the DXF , no extension needed, and hit enter. That will (should) save the DXF next to the .seg file you have open. To get the DXF out of the segment level, which is burried in the project file, you go to Windows File Manager, and do an Expand branch until you get down to that level. Then you can use F7 for a transfer file directly into the 3DS/Meshes directory. Then load it using the defaults. It always works for me and I never have to reverse normals or do any smoothing. Just Apply mapping coords. and you're set. Hope this helps. Regards, Sanford
